Output e25e21acaf0a8b5ffe12d3efad170168b1f543966390d8e7ce81d9e055cbaaf1:0

value
6978342559038
script pubkey
OP_0 OP_PUSHBYTES_20 18d1ed902fb7266562bc493df04346fefefb7c18
address
tb1qrrg7myp0kunx2c4ufy7lqs6xlml0klqcc3qf80
transaction
e25e21acaf0a8b5ffe12d3efad170168b1f543966390d8e7ce81d9e055cbaaf1
confirmations
189262
spent
true